Abstract

Background: Refillable drinking water has become a widely used alternative among the public because it is considered more efficient and affordable. However, if the management process does not comply with hygiene and sanitation standards, refillable drinking water is at risk of being contaminated with Escherichia coli bacteria, which can cause diarrhea. Objective: To analyze the management of refillable drinking water in relation to its bacteriological quality (Escherichia coli) in the Kacang Pedang Community Health Center (UPTD Puskesmas) area. Methods: This study employed a qualitative descriptive design. The study subjects were all 6 drinking water depots, with a total of 12 drinking water samples collected. Data were collected through laboratory testing for Escherichia coli content using the Most Probable Number (MPN) method and in-depth interviews. Findings: Laboratory test results showed that none of the 12 refilled drinking water samples contained Escherichia coli (0/100 ml). The facility inspection revealed that the depots were clean, and no vectors or pests were found. Regarding equipment, the storage of raw water, filtration, disinfection using ultraviolet (UV) light, rinsing, filling, and sealing of the water jugs were all carried out in accordance with hygiene and sanitation procedures. Implications: The management of refillable drinking water in the area served by the Kacang Pedang Community Health Center (UPTD Puskesmas), as assessed in terms of Escherichia coli levels, facilities, and equipment, has met the bacteriological quality requirements for drinking water as stipulated in Indonesian Ministry of Health Regulation No. 2 of 2023; therefore, the drinking water produced is safe for consumption.
